Market Size Will Shock You
The global shapewear market hit $3.2 billion in 2024. Plus size products make up 40% of all sales. Most big brands still treat plus size as unimportant.
Plus size shoppers spend 30% more on shapewear than regular customers. They struggle to find products that fit well. When they find good brands, they stay loyal for years.

Problems That Create Business Opportunities
Regular shapewear doesn't work for plus size women. Common problems include rolling up, bunching, and poor support. Products don't fit right and come in limited styles.
Comfort is the most important thing to these customers. They pay extra for shapewear that doesn't hurt or need adjusting. Brands that make comfortable products build loyal customer bases.

High-Waisted Shapers Are Top Sellers
High-waisted shapewear makes up 60% of plus size sales. These products help with tummy control and waist shaping. They work with many different outfit styles.
New features can increase prices. Seamless construction and moisture-wicking fabric cost more. Brands with these features make 40% more per sale.
Full-Body Products Bring Higher Profits
Bodysuits and full-torso shapers cost more to make. But they solve many problems at once. Customers pay $80 to $150 for these products.
Success depends on solving fit problems unique to plus size bodies. Good seaming and compression make the difference. Products that fit well get good reviews.
Special Occasion Items Command Premium Prices
Wedding shapewear and formal event products cost the most. Brides spend over $300 on average for shapewear and accessories. This market is worth $200 million per year.
These special products sell for 3 to 4 times regular prices. Manufacturing costs stay similar to everyday shapewear. The emotional factor makes customers willing to pay more.

Inventory Management Works Better
Plus size shapewear has predictable demand patterns. Core styles sell steadily for years. This reduces inventory risk and improves cash flow.
Size distribution also helps with inventory planning. Sizes 1X to 3X make up 70% of sales. Businesses can focus money on best-selling sizes.

Better Fit Technology Reduces Returns
Virtual fitting and AI size recommendations help customers choose correctly. Returns can eat up 15% to 25% of revenue. Fit technology investments pay for themselves quickly.
3D body scanning helps create better patterns. This leads to products that fit better. Good fit creates positive reviews and repeat customers.

Photos Must Show Real Results
Plus size shapewear needs special photography approaches. Customers want to see products on similar body types. Diverse models are needed for good conversion rates.
Before and after photos help customers make decisions. Multiple angles and construction details build confidence. Brands with comprehensive photos see 30% to 40% higher sales.
Size Charts Drive Profits
Accurate size charts reduce returns and build confidence. Interactive guides and personalized recommendations improve shopping. Video sizing guides work better than static charts.
Good customer education reduces returns by 20% to 30%. It also improves review scores. Size chart investment pays for itself quickly.
